このガイドについて
教育現場では日々多くの業務に追われており、効率化が求められています。Google Apps Script (GAS)を活用すれば、 プログラミングの専門知識がなくても、簡単にウェブアプリを作成して業務を自動化できます。
このガイドでは、GASとスプレッドシートを活用した教育用ウェブアプリの開発方法をステップバイステップで解説します。 プログラミング初心者の方でも、実践的なウェブアプリを作成できるようになることを目指しています。
特に生成AIを活用することで、コーディングの知識がなくてもアプリ開発が可能になります。 このガイドを通じて、教育現場の効率化と学習環境の向上に貢献できるスキルを身につけましょう。
対象読者:教育関係者、プログラミング初心者、学校のICT担当者など
ガイドの構成
本ガイドは、基礎から応用まで体系的に学習できるよう7つのパートに分かれています。 各パートは段階的に知識を深められるよう構成されており、興味のある部分から読み進めることも可能です。
学習のポイント:各チャプターの内容を実際に試しながら進めると、より理解が深まります。
目次
GASで作る教育現場向けウェブアプリ開発完全ガイド
- 第I部:導入と基礎知識
- 1. はじめに
- 2. GASのメリットと学校現場との親和性
- 3. 教育現場で役立つGASウェブアプリのアイデア
- 第II部:開発の準備と基本
- 4. GASの基本環境設定
- 5. GASでウェブアプリを作る基本手順
- 6. 生成AIを活用したGASコード作成の基本
- 7. 効果的なプロンプト作成テクニック
- 第III部:実装の基礎
- 8. AIが生成したコードの活用方法
- 9. スプレッドシートの基本操作
- 10. HTMLとCSSの基礎知識
- 11. サーバーサイドとクライアントサイドの連携
- 第IV部:アプリ開発の実践
- 12. 小学校向けアプリ開発例
- 13. 中高校向けアプリ開発例
- 14. 教員向け校務効率化アプリ例
- 15. 保護者連携アプリ例
- 第V部:応用テクニック
- 16. UIデザインの工夫
- 17. データベース設計の応用
- 18. レスポンス管理と処理の最適化
- 19. コードの統合と競合解決
- 第VI部:テスト・デバッグ・デプロイ
- 20. エラー処理の基本
- 21. よくあるエラーとその解決法
- 22. テストとデバッグの基本
- 23. デプロイと共有
- 24. セキュリティと個人情報保護
- 第VII部:発展と将来展望
- 25. 実際の開発プロセス例
- 26. 応用テクニック
- 27. 他システムとの連携
- 28. 学校全体での活用展開
- 29. GASとAIの今後の可能性
- 30. まとめと学習リソース